Before working with a financial advisor, it is imperative to see whether or not they have any disclosures and if they do, whether or not you are comfortable with the disclosures that are on their record.
Disclosures in the financial services industry fall under the following categories: criminal or civil penalties, customer disputes, fines, regulatory actions, financial, civil bonds, liens, separations with employers or judgments.
